i think the phone is awesome, mine didnt really lag, both phones were pretty snappy . only laggy thing i guess could have been the scrolling, it could have been smoother, but switching menu's and going in and out of programs was quick. talking to Sprint CS and store the vibe on the phone is no one is bringing it back for problems and the batttery is indeed great. i had it off the charger at 9 am yesterday and at 2 am this morning is was still at 60% thats 40 % used in 15 hours not bad at all, and im texting talking and messing with the phone all day listening to music, videos, even a half a episode of NCIS. I really like the phone so when i heard all these good things about it and mine was locking up i thought something had to be wrong.

try a few things before bringing it back.. on the auto end feature leave out anything involving phone or google out, only run the apps you install, or better yet dont put anything on the auto end. next uninstall 1 program at a time and see if the phone still locks up. if it does then reinstall and unistall a different program till you find the colprit, im pretty sure the locking and freezing is caused by either those 2 things the task manage and or the apps.

as far as your EVO question my brother has it, sure its nice has a big screen and it has some coolness to it.. but i cant stand the battery life and i need a keyboard, plus they both run the same OS so there really not much different.
